There are many ways to choose box sizes, and percentages definitely seem better which is why I implemented that in QPnf. There were some studies done that seemed to say that a 2.38% (which is close to the 2.33 for log charts) box size was a good one for daily charts and that is what I use. I move the decimal around for intraday charts -- like 0.238% per box etc. Average true range is a good thing too -- but I don't have that implemented automatically, but if you have the number for a stock, you can plug it into QPnf and you'll get that box size.
